ATP: Zverev defeated in Stockholm quarter-finals, Struff eliminated

Mischa Zverev (Hamburg/No. 5) made it to the quarter-finals at the ATP tournament in Sweden’s capital Stockholm, while Jan-Lennard Struff (Warstein) finished in the second round.

Zverev won convincingly against Viktor Troicki (Serbia) 6-2,6-3 and now meets Grigor Dimitrov (No. 1) from Bulgaria. Struff was defeated by the Argentine Juan Martin Del Potro (no. 4)2:6,6:7 (6:8).

Zverev, number 30 in the world rankings, has lost his two duels so far with top seed Dimitrov. Both matches took place this year and went close to the Bulgarians. Zverev now has the chance to take revenge at the tournament in Stockholm, which is endowed with around 660,000 euros.
